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a specialized loc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are geared up to manage a vast array of concerns, from basic key duplications to complex elect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mith professionals, in specific, are professionals who can come to your location,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to supply instant assistance.
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Duplication
- Standard Keys: If you require an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can quickly duplicate your existing key.
- Remote Keys: For cars with keyless entry systems, car locksmiths can program and duplic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and begin your car without problems.
Lockout Assistance
- ** unlocking Doors **: If you've locked your keys in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ely unlock your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
- Ignition Lockout: For situations where you can't begin your car due to the fact that the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can help extract it.
Key Replacement
-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can create a brand-new one using the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.
- Broken Keys: If your key is damaged or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make sure the new key works effortlessly with your car.
Transponder Key Programming
- New Keys: Many contemporary cars come with transponder keys, which require programming to the car locksmith mobile's onboard computer. An exp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to ensure it works properly.
- Reprogramming: If your transponder key has actually quit working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its functionality.
Lock Installation and Repair
- New Locks: If your car's locks are broken or harmed, a car locksmith can set up brand-new, premium locks.
- Lock Repair: For minor issues like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to ensure smooth operation.
Security Upgrades
- High-Security Locks: For added assurance, a car locksmith can install high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.
- Immobilizer Systems: These advanced security systems prevent your car from beginning if the appropriate key is not present. A car locksmith can install and program immobilizer systems.

FAQs About Car Locksmith Services
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ith help if I lock my type in the car?
- A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can safely unlock your car without triggering any damage. They are geared up with tools and strategies to handle various lockout circumstances.
Q2: How much does it cost to get a new car key made?

- A2: The expense can vary depending on the kind of key and the complexity of the vehicle's lock system. Standard ke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.
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?
- A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er system. This is a typical service for modern-day vehicles that require this type of key.
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
- A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to force it out. Instead, call a mobile car locksmith who can securely extract the broken key and offer a replacement if necessary.
Q5: How can I prevent being locked out of my car?
- A5: Keep a spare key in a safe location, such as a trusted friend's house or a safe key box. Routinely inspect your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.
Q6: Are mobile car locksmiths reliable?
- A6: Yes, mobile car locksmith professionals are generally dependable. Search for specialists with excellent reviews, correct licensing, and a performance history of pleased customers.
Tips for Maintaining Your Car Locks and Keys
Regular Lubrication
- Use a silicone-based lubricant to keep your locks and keys moving smoothly. This can avoid wear and tear and lower the risk of lockouts.
Avoid Excessive Force
- When placing or turning your key, avoid utilizing excessive force. This can damage the lock or key and lead to more serious concerns.
Keep Your Keys Safe
- Store your car type in a secure and accessible location. Avoid positioning them near windows or in locations where they can be easily stolen.
Inspect Locks Regularly
- Regularly check your car locks for any signs of wear, rust, or damage. If you notice any problems, have them checked and fixed by a professional locksmith.
Think About Keyless Entry Systems
- If your vehicle supports it, think about upgrading to a keyless entry system. These systems can decrease the threat of lockouts and supply additional security.
